The PhD degree program in Urban Studies at the University of Wisconsin Milwaukee is designed to prepare individuals to obtain employment in academic departments, as well as government institutions and social agencies, and to conduct sophisticated research in the field of urban studies.
Programme Structure
Courses include:
- Seminar: Research Methods in Urban Studies
- Contemporary Urban Social Structure and Change
- Urban Social Structure
- Seminar in Urban Political Process
- The Internal Structure of the City
- Seminar on the History of American Urban Problems
- Spatial Analysis
- The Quantitative Analysis of Historical Data
- Advanced Statistical Methods in Sociology
